Seafood Restaurants in Greenwood, IN
Seafood Restaurants
718 US 31 N,
Greenwood ,
IN
46142
UNITED STATES
Fast casual restaurant chain specializing in a variety of seafood
Worldwide > United States > Greenwood, IN > Seafood Restaurants